What the Data Says About Maryalice
The Social Security Administration has registered 2,485 babies named Maryalice between 1899 and 2024, spanning 126 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a girl's name, Maryalice currently holds the #7959 rank among girls for 2024. The name reached its historical peak in 1947, when 51 babies received it in a single year.
Decade-level aggregation shows that Maryalice performed strongest in the 1940s, accumulating 358 births during that ten-year window. Across the 14 decades of recorded activity, Maryalice shows a clear decline from its mid-century high. Geographically, the name is most concentrated in New York, which accounts for 192 births — the largest state-level total in the dataset — followed by Pennsylvania and Texas. In total, SSA state-level files list Maryalice in 10 of the 51 U.S. reporting jurisdictions.
No etymological entry is currently available for Maryalice in our reference dataset. These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 2,485 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
